Understanding 45ft Containers

A 45ft container, also referred to as a high cube container, is a standardized shipping unit that determines 45 feet in length, 8 feet in width, and 9 feet 6 inches in height. These dimensions provide a considerable advantage over the more typical 20ft and 40ft containers, permitting increased cargo capacity and versatility in filling and unloading.

Key Features:

  • Dimensions:
    • Length: 45 feet (13.716 meters)
    • Width: 8 feet (2.438 meters)
    • Height: 9 feet 6 inches (2.9 meters)
  • Volume: Approximately 3,465 cubic feet (98.1 cubic meters)
  • Weight Capacity: Up to 67,200 pounds (30,472 kg)

The 45ft container is designed to fulfill the extensive demands of maritime and land transportation, guaranteeing that items remain secure and intact throughout transit. These containers are built from high-strength products, such as corrosion-resistant steel, and are geared up with robust locking systems and ventilation systems to safeguard the cargo.

Building and construction and Materials

The construction of a 45ft container includes a mix of resilient and lightweight materials to guarantee both strength and effectiveness. The main components consist of:

  • Frame: The frame is generally made from sturdy steel, providing the structural integrity required to hold up against the stresses of long-distance travel.
  • Walls: The walls are built from corrugated steel sheets, which enhance the container's rigidity and resistance to deformation.
  • Doors: High-quality doors with several locking points are vital for protecting the cargo. These doors are often geared up with gaskets to avoid water and dust ingress.
  • Floor: The floor is typically made of plywood or wood slabs, enhanced with steel beams to support heavy loads and provide a stable base for stacking and securing cargo.
  • Roofing system: The roof is constructed from steel and is developed to be water tight, securing the contents from the components.
  • Ventilation: Some 45ft containers are fitted with ventilation systems to make sure that temperature-sensitive or perishable goods stay in ideal conditions during transportation.

Benefits of 45ft Containers

  1. Increased Cargo Capacity:

    • Volume: The bigger volume of 45ft containers permits organizations to ship more products in a single unit, minimizing the number of containers needed and reducing transportation expenses.
    • Efficiency: With more goods per container, logistics operations end up being more efficient, as fewer handling and filling operations are required.
  2. Flexibility in Loading:

    • Door Options: 45ft containers often come with roll-up doors or double doors, making it easier to fill and dump big or bulky items.
    • Customizations: These containers can be modified to consist of unique features such as temperature control, humidity regulation, and additional security steps.
  3. Economical:

    • Economies of Scale: Shippers can take advantage of economies of scale by utilizing bigger containers, as the cost per unit of cargo is often lower.
    • Lowered Handling: Fewer containers indicate fewer handling operations, which can lower the risk of damage and accelerate the total shipping procedure.
  4. Ecological Impact:

    • Fuel Efficiency: Larger containers can be transferred more effectively, minimizing the carbon footprint per unit of cargo.
    • Lowered Waste: By combining shipments into larger containers, services can decrease the requirement for excess packaging and minimize waste.
  5. Versatility:

    • Various Cargo Types: 45ft shipping container containers appropriate for a wide variety of cargo, consisting of machinery, furnishings, automotive parts, and durable goods.
    • Intermodal Transport: These containers can be easily moved between different modes of transportation, such as ships, trains, and trucks, without the need for repackaging.

Common Uses of 45ft Containers

  1. Retail and Consumer Goods:

    • Bulk Shipments: Retailers often use 45ft containers to deliver large amounts of durable goods, such as clothes, electronic devices, and home appliances.
    • Seasonal Inventory: These containers are perfect for transporting seasonal inventory, guaranteeing that products show up on time and in great condition.
  2. Automotive Industry:

    • Vehicle Parts: Auto makers depend on 45ft containers to transfer car parts, equipment, and tools.
    • Finished Vehicles: Some specialized 45ft containers are created to carry completed cars, offering a cost-efficient service for automotive logistics.
  3. Equipment and Heavy Equipment:

    • Industrial Machinery: The bigger size of 45ft containers makes them ideal for shipping heavy industrial equipment and devices.
    • Building and construction Materials: These containers are often utilized to transfer building products, such as steel beams, concrete, and building supplies.
  4. Furnishings and Interiors:

    • Large Furniture Items: Furniture makers and retailers utilize 45ft containers to ship big products like sofas, beds, and dining sets.
    • Interior Decoration Projects: These containers are ideal for carrying products for massive interior decoration projects, such as custom furnishings and design.
  5. Perishable Goods:

    • Refrigerated Containers: Specialized 45ft refrigerated containers, known as reefers, are utilized to transport temperature-sensitive goods like food, pharmaceuticals, and flowers.
    • Ventilated Containers: Ventilated 45ft containers are used for items that need air flow, such as vegetables and fruits.

Frequently Asked Questions About 45ft Containers

Q: What is the difference between a 45ft container and a 40ft container?

  • A: The main distinction is the length. A reliable 45ft Containers container is 5 feet longer than a 40ft container, using more cargo space. In addition, 45ft containers typically have a higher weight capacity and might come with advanced features like roll-up doors and ventilation systems.

Q: How much cargo can a 45ft container hold?

  • A: A 45ft container delivery container can hold around 3,465 cubic feet (98.1 cubic meters) of cargo. The exact weight capacity can vary, but it is generally around 67,200 pounds (30,472 kg).

Q: Are 45ft containers suitable for all kinds of cargo?

  • A: While 45ft containers are extremely flexible, they might not appropriate for all types of cargo. For instance, incredibly heavy or oversized items might need specific containers. It's essential to assess the specific needs of your cargo and pick the proper container size and type.

Q: What are the primary advantages of utilizing a 45ft container?

  • A: The primary advantages include increased cargo capacity, versatility in filling and unloading, cost-effectiveness, reduced environmental impact, and flexibility in dealing with different types of cargo.

Q: How do 45ft containers impact shipping costs?

  • A: Using 45ft containers can reduce shipping expenses due to the increased cargo capacity. Less containers mean fewer handling operations, lower transport charges, and prospective cost savings on custom-mades duties and other logistics expenses.

Q: Are 45ft containers more costly than 40ft containers?

  • A: Generally, 45ft cargo worthy container containers are a little more pricey than 40ft containers due to their larger size and higher capacity. However, the increased performance and reduced managing expenses can typically balance out the preliminary greater cost.

Q: Can 45ft containers be utilized for intermodal transport?

  • A: Yes, 45ft containers are designed for intermodal transport, allowing them to be quickly moved in between ships, trains, and trucks. This makes them a flexible choice for long-distance and global shipments.
